Symptoms of Gluten Intolerance and Celiac Disease

One of the most common questions asked in the forum is how to know if you are gluten intolerant or have celiac disease. While both conditions can cause similar symptoms, there are some key differences to be aware of.

Gluten Intolerance is a condition in which a person has difficulty digesting gluten, a protein found in wheat, rye, and barley. Symptoms of gluten intolerance can include bloating, gas, abdominal pain, diarrhea, and constipation.

Celiac Disease is an autoimmune disorder in which the body's immune system attacks the small intestine when gluten is consumed. Symptoms of celiac disease can include fatigue, anemia, weight loss, and abdominal swelling.

Diagnosis and Testing

If you suspect that you may be gluten intolerant or have celiac disease, it is important to consult your doctor. They will be able to order tests to determine if you have either condition. The most common test used to diagnose gluten intolerance is the ELISA (en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ay) test, which measures the levels of antibodies in the blood that are produced when gluten is consumed.

For celiac disease, the gold standard test is the biopsy of the small intestine, which can determine if the villi (tiny finger-like projections in the small intestine) have been damaged by the immune system.

Treatment

The treatment for both gluten intolerance and celiac disease is a gluten-free diet. This means avoiding foods that contain gluten such as breads, pastas, and cereals. It is important to read food labels carefully to ensure that all the ingredients are gluten-free.

It is also important to consult a dietitian or nutritionist to ensure that you are getting all the nutrients you need while following a gluten-free diet.

If you think you may be gluten intolerant or have celiac disease, it is important to talk to your doctor. Your doctor can run tests to determine if your symptoms are caused by gluten or another condition.

There are two main tests for gluten intolerance and celiac disease. The first is the tTG-IgA test (tissue transglutaminase antibody test). This test measures the presence of antibodies in your blood that are produced when your body’s immune system reacts to gluten. If this test is positive, it may indicate that you have an intolerance to gluten.

The second test is an endoscopy. During this procedure, your doctor will insert a small camera into your stomach and take samples from your small intestine. These samples can be tested for damage caused by gluten. If the test results show that you have damage to your small intestine, it could be a sign of celiac disease.

Other tests that your doctor may perform to determine if you have a gluten intolerance or celiac disease include a biopsy, blood tests, and a stool sample test.

In addition to testing, your doctor may ask you about your symptoms and any family history of gluten intolerance or celiac disease. It is important to be honest and thorough when answering these questions.

If you are diagnosed with gluten intolerance or celiac disease, your doctor will likely advise you to follow a gluten-free diet. This diet eliminates all foods that contain gluten, which includes wheat, barley, rye, and some oats. Your doctor may also recommend taking supplements to ensure that you are getting all the nutrients your body needs.

Finally, it is important to remember that not everyone who has a gluten intolerance or celiac disease will experience symptoms. If you think you may be gluten intolerant or have celiac disease, it is important to talk to your doctor and get tested.
